The SHU Ride Public Safety Drivers primary purpose is to protect life and property. This is accomplished by providing a safe and reliable transportation service to and from the campus on a fixed zone. In addition to providing transportation and enforcement of Universitys rules and regulations they will complete written reports on all security related matters and provide information and assistance to students staff and the general public. Furthermore they assist South Orange Police Fire and Rescue Squad when necessary or as required.
Duties and Responsibilities:
1. SHU Ride Transportation:
Provide transportation to and from areas within the SHU Ride zone for SHU community members.
Utilize an IPad along with the Tripshot application to acknowledge ride requests
The SHU Ride Driver ensures each community member swipes their ID card on a hand-held card reader
Use hand-held radios to communicate with dispatchers regarding SHU community member pick-up/drop off locations
Use wheelchair accessible vehicles to accommodate students with disabilities
Maintain comprehensive knowledge on the SHU Ride operations and utilities such as operation of vehicles maintenance of vehicles the SHU Ride application and dispatch log
Will work a late evening early morning shift
Will work on weekends
Will work overtime as needed
2. Maintenance:
SHU Ride Driver must inspect the vehicle at the beginning and end of their shift. Therefore checking the oil tire pressure lights gas and cleanliness of the vehicle.
The driver will inspect and test the hydraulic wheelchair lift once per shift to ensure that the mechanism is Vehicle functioning properly on the Bus.
SHU Ride drivers will submit a vehicle inspection sheet at the end of their shift.
3. Create and maintain all departmental detailed documentation for reporting and investigative purposes including:
Complete departmental incident report
Calls for service: escorts jumpstarts and lock outs
Complete motor vehicle accident report
Generate property reports
Complete work orders that identify safety concerns in need of attention from the Facility Engineering staff.
4. Public Safety is the 1st responder to all emergency calls occurring on campus including but not limited to:
Medical emergencies (provide CPR AED and First Aid) Narcan
Fire alarms
Bomb Threats
Intrusion alarms
Maintenance
5. Customer service by:
Providing directions
Escorts/Transportation on and off campus
Vehicular jumpstarts
Vehicle lockouts
Required Qualifications:
High School Diploma or GED. 1-3 years of relevant work experience. Relevant work experience may include experience in Public Safety Military Police or Criminal Justice coursework. Must be able to operate a 14-passenger vehicle. Must be in good physical condition and have a good driving record.
Desired Qualifications:
Community policing course CPR AED First Aid certification basic computer skills have knowledge of alarm systems the ability to write a clear and concise report be able to clearly communicate directions instructions as well as work well under pressure.
Licenses and Certificates:
Valid New Jersey drivers license required with a good driving record.
Salary Range:
$15.49 $20.90
